Frequently Asked Questions about Long Island City
How much are Studio apartments in Long Island City?
There are currently 9,073 Studio Apartments in Long Island City with rent ranges from $1,600 to $9,900 with an average price of $3,955.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Long Island City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Long Island City ranges from $1,000 to $16,279 with an average monthly rent of $4,968.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Long Island City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Long Island City range from $1,800 to $30,240.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$6,289.
How expensive are Long Island City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,776 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Long Island City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,500 to $37,950 - averaging $7,829 for the location.
